Well, the Hijri date 20 Rabi Al Awwal 1366 corresponds to the Gregorian date Tuesday, 11 February 1947. This date lies in the third month of the Hijri year 1366 AH, which is Rabi Al-Awwal of 1366 AH. Both this Hijri and Gregorian date occur on the single day that is Tuesday without any doubt. The Arabic date 1366/03/20 is calculated using the Umm Al-Qura calendar and the sighting of the moon. One thing to remember is that this Arabic date may occur on different Gregorian date depending upon the region and country and obviously the moon.

Sahih al-Bukhari
Friday Prayer
Chapter: When the Imam is delivering the Khutba, a light two Rak'a Salat (prayer) (Tahayyat-ul Masjid)
Narrated Jabir:
A man entered the Mosque while the Prophet (ﷺ) was delivering the Khutba. The Prophet (ﷺ) said to him, "Have you prayed?" The man replied in the negative. The Prophet (ﷺ) said, "Pray two rak`at."
Sahih al-Bukhari 931
